Fleet curtain-sider case study
Followmont Transport — five-unit 14-pallet curtain-sider fleet.
Queensland-manufactured freight bodies configured for efficient pallet access, load management and delivery locations without dedicated loading infrastructure.

Verified project summary
Five vehicles built to one fleet specification.
Customer requirement.
Followmont required a consistent five-vehicle production lot for pallet distribution across loading docks, forklift-accessible facilities and delivery locations without dedicated loading infrastructure.
Kirin’s response.
Kirin manufactured and fitted five 14-pallet curtain-siders with quick-release side access, load-rated internal gates and an integrated tail-lift rear closure. The common specification supports repeatable fleet presentation and practical multi-stop operation.
Loading and delivery configuration.
The Attards quick-release system provides broad side access for forklift loading. At the rear, the Anteo F3CL22 tail lift functions as both the rear closure and loading platform, removing the need for separate swing doors.
Loads must be secured according to their weight, position and applicable load-restraint requirements.
